Abstract
A method for diagnosing a battery according to one aspect of the present disclosure includes a differential profile generating step of generating a differential profile representing a relationship between a differential capacity, which is obtained by differentiating a capacity of a battery with respect to a voltage of the battery, and the voltage, for each predetermined diagnosis cycle; a target peak detecting step of detecting a target peak in which a differential capacity value decreases and then increases or a voltage value increases and then decreases as a usage time of the battery increases, among peaks of the differential profile; a peak information obtaining step of obtaining target peak information including the differential capacity value and the voltage value of the target peak from each of the plurality of differential profiles generated while the diagnosis cycle is repeated multiple times; and a diagnosing step of diagnosing a state of the battery based on the target peak information obtained from the plurality of differential profiles.
